She looked at me, the cat. She stayed snoring delightfully in her favourite spot: the warm stones. It was her regular spot, every morning, and I could understand why. From here she had the perfect view over Mogán harbour, with its quaint houses painted blue and white, a beautiful contrast to the brightly coloured Bougainville with its purple and rose-red hues.
It was 08:00, the sky was already gently warmed by the first rays of sunlight. The village slowly awoke, the soft sounds of the morning filling the air. In the distance, I could hear the calm sound of waves as the first fishing boats returned from their night journey.
A little further on, a group gathered for their daily yoga class. The instructor's calm movements added a sense of serenity to the morning. People began rolling out their mats, their bodies still tired from the night, but the yoga class brought new energy.
The cat watched the scene, her eyes full of calm and wisdom. Everything was perfect in this little paradise, where time seemed to slow down and the world briefly detached itself from the frenzy of the outside world. And as I sat there in silence, I realised that, like the kitty, I was exactly where I needed to be at this moment.
